Engine Lubrication: Testing and Inspection



Measuring Oil Consumption:





NOTE: The oil consumption is determined with the oil dipstick with millimeter graduation and the appropriate test sheet. It should not exceed 1.51/1000km.

The procedure for the oil consumption measurement is described on the front page of the test sheet.

The oil consumption indicated on the dipstick in mm can be read off in cubic cm by means of the diagram at the back of the test sheet.

In order to avoid wrong measurements, the engine oil must be checked for fuel dilution before conducting the consumption measurement.

On engines with a thermostat in the oil filter it is necessary during venting that the flow passes to the air oil cooler, i.e. the thermostat must be opened. For this purpose, run engine with increased idle speed until the thermostat opens (clear rise of the temperature on the air oil cooler can be felt).

Test Sheet for Oil Consumption Test

M9:





Test oil consumption with new engine oil. Prior to the test, check engine for exterior oil leaks.
1. Park vehicle on level area and mark vehicle position.
2. Drain or extract used engine oil and top up with new engine oil to approx.5 mm below the maximum marking of the engine oil dipstick.
3. On vehicles equipped with air/oil cooler (not air/oil coolers below RH wheel house), install check valve 110 589 00 91 00 between oil cooler and hose (on top of oil cooler). The arrow stamped in the check valve must point towards the oil filter.
4. With the engine idling and oil flowing through the cooler (oil cooler must be warm), bleed oil cooler and hose at the two bleeder screws of the check valve. Shut off engine.
5. Check engine oil level. If necessary, top up or extract to 5 mm below the maximum marking of the engine oil dipstick
6. Raise engine oil temperature to 80 °C. Measure oil temperature with telethermometer 124 589 07 21 00.
7. Shut off engine. Wait exactly 5 minutes,then measure oil level with dipstick 115 589 15 21 00. The millimeter graduation of the oil dipstick must point towards the engine. Withdraw oil dipstick after 3 seconds and read off Oil level In mm. Read off the oil quantity (mm) corresponding to the oil level (mm) from the diagram on the oil consumption test sheet and enter on the test sheet.

CAUTION: During the 5 minutes waiting period. unscrew the central bolt of the upright oil filter (model 126) and lift for approx 1 minute in order that the oil should drain from the oil filter housing. Tighten central bolt to 25-30 Nm.

8. Make an oil consumption road test over a distance of at least 100 km on expressways or trunk roads. As far as possible, choose operating conditions similar to those at the customer's.
9. Park vehicle on marked area and repeat jobs listed under stps 4, 6 and 7.

CAUTION: Switch off engine and allow engine oil to cool down to 80° C. Before the measuring process (item 4). Run engine for approx. 10 seconds, pumping the accelerator.

10. Calculate oil consumption in liters/1000 km on the basis of the consumed oil quantity (ccm) and test distance (oil consumption road test in km).
